WHAT IS PROPOSITION 63? Proposition 63 is a California ballot proposition that would require a background check and California department of justice authorization to the purchase of weapons, and possession of large capacity of ammunition.
Proposition 63 would also create a new law that has the capacity to take firearms away from people that had been convicted of crimes before. This people are not allowed to own firearms or a large quantity of ammunition. The law requires that convicted individuals to either give away their firearms to local law enforcement or sell them / give to a licensed firearm dealer.
In September 2016 a Los Angeles Times poll showed 64% percent of registered voters in favor of Proposition 63, and 28% opposed, and 8% unknown.
